Finding Calm in the Chaos: A Guide to Mindfulness Meditation

In our rapidly-changing world, it's easy to feel overwhelmed and stressed. Routine life often presents a whirlwind of expectations, leaving little room for peace and tranquility. Nevertheless, there's a powerful tool that can help us navigate these turbulent waters: mindfulness meditation. This practice, rooted in ancient wisdom, cultivates present-moment awareness and acceptance.

Mindfulness meditation involves paying attention to the here and now, observing our feelings without judgment. It's about nurturing a kind awareness of our inner experience.

Here are some simple steps to get started with mindfulness meditation:

  • Find a quiet place where you can sit or lie down comfortably.
  • Rest your your eyes and take to focus on your respirations.
  • Pay attention to the sensations of your breath as it enters and leaves your body.
  • If your mind drifts, gently guide your attention back to your inhalation and exhalation.
  • Continue this for 5-10 minutes, or longer if you wish.

Over time, regular mindfulness meditation can decrease stress, improve focus, and enhance overall well-being. It's a journey of self-discovery and integration that can bring lasting peace to your life.

Minimize Tension, Maximize Wellbeing: Straightforward Strategies for Anxiety Relief

Feeling overwhelmed by anxiety can rob you of life's joys. Luckily, there are many practical techniques you can implement to manage stress and nurture a sense of calmness. Initiate by engaging in mindfulness through meditation or deep breathing exercises. These practices help in centering your mind and body.

  • Moreover, prioritize self-care activities like getting enough sleep, eating a healthy diet, and engaging in regular exercise.
  • Bond with loved ones and build strong social networks. Sharing your feelings with trusted individuals can provide invaluable support.
  • Consider seeking professional help from a therapist or counselor if you are struggling to control your anxiety on your own.

Remember that managing anxiety is an ongoing endeavor. Be patient with yourself, celebrate your progress, and continue to implement these techniques to live a more meaningful life.
